The Real Threat is Spain, Not Greece: Sullivan
Greece who? The greatest threat to the global economy has quickly shifted west to Spain. Spain’s stock market and big bank stocks continue to tumble. The benchmark IBEX 35 index is down 10 percent since Jan. 1 and nearly 30 percent over the past year. Here’s the fear: Banco Santander, BBVA and the third largest bank in Spain, La Caixa, have combined assets of about $2.7 trillion. Spain’s GDP is just about $1.4 trillion. In other words: Spain’s three biggest banks are nearly twice as big as the entire Spanish economy. For this reason alone, Ben Bernanke and central bankers around Europe are right to be ...
